Subject: net: dsa: mv88e6xxx: Enable CMODE config support for 6390X

From: Martin Hundeb�ll <mnhu@prevas.dk>


[ Upstream commit bb0a2675f72b458e64f47071e8aabdb225a6af4d ]

Commit f39908d3b1c45 ('net: dsa: mv88e6xxx: Set the CMODE for mv88e6390
ports 9 & 10') added support for setting the CMODE for the 6390X family,
but only enabled it for 9290 and 6390 - and left out 6390X.

Fix support for setting the CMODE on 6390X also by assigning
mv88e6390x_port_set_cmode() to the .port_set_cmode function pointer in
mv88e6390x_ops too.
